1938-1939 Pickup infor wanted.
 

I have a friend that his son inherited a 1939 Ford pickup that has sat for years after having a front end accident. He would like to know if any other year Ford pickup front clip would bolt up to his '39 other than a 1938 with out a major challenge? PM me or email me if you think you an answer or Post it here.

been a lot of pick up 38/39 parts advertised on the Barn, look them up. doors off a 40 to 47 will fit but the trim lines are not the same. I have a 39 ds door that is very good if you need one.

You talking about the sheet metal only? Its going to be only the '38/39 pickup parts. I have seen car front ends that have been fitted to them and they look good but its not a simple bolt on deal.
